Unknown publication date. 3rd printing of 1979 edition:- Synopsis: The Black Magician lives. And vows that Thongor must die! The stranger throws back his cloak - Mardanax! The Black Magician of Zaar has survived Thongor's destruction of the dread City of Magicians. With a hellish gleam in his emerald eyes, he orders, "Go to thy master and say that Mardanax hath come. I have lived to see the barbarian Thongor n his tomb". And Mandarax is as evil as his word. With unholy power, he strikes Thongor dead, drugs Thongor's beautiful queen into mindless obedience, kidnaps his son. Thongor's empire has fallen to the forces of Chaos.
